Output 5ab1efd5a28d3e09c139aa332ac05d921d9c6623f6520f21e63af69d4d2718f1:0

value
32534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70ca561e1bb8c52108acd926cd64dde0b948063 OP_EQUAL
address
3QDHyb1B3MazM6gPoJdbAnu77qnfdC6vmv
transaction
5ab1efd5a28d3e09c139aa332ac05d921d9c6623f6520f21e63af69d4d2718f1
spent
true